On selecting the value of drying temperature, use the following procedure:
Determine moisture content in a sample
Determine temperature of substance chemical decomposition by tests
Compare result obtained on a moisture analyzer with the one of traditional
method
When drying a sample with high humidity
content, it is possible to shorten
measurement time by selecting “Step” or
“Quick” drying mode. In such case, the
majority of moisture content is released
when drying temperature higher than set.
Only after some time, the temperature is
lowered to the set value, and maintained
until completing drying process.
13.4. Selecting a drying mode
The software of moisture analyzer MAX series enables selecting one of four
drying modes:
Standard
Quick
Mild
Step
STANDARD mode
Standard mode is the most frequently used of all
drying modes. It enables accurate determining of
moisture content is a dried sample
.
MILD mode
Mild mode is used in case of drying substances that
are sensitive to rapid heat emitted by filaments
operating at full power in the initial stage of drying
process. This mode prevents from decomposing of
substances sensitive to heat by mild temperature
increase in set amount of time (time interval has to be
selected by tests). Mild mode is recommended to
drying samples of leather structure.
